3 Tips For Maintaining Roof Shingles

Watch For Green

You want the surface of your shingles to be as clear as possible, but a damp roof can be an excellent spot for moss, mold, and fungus. When moss grows on the surface, its roots can lift the roof shingles. This then creates more space for mold, algae, and fungus to grow, which can eventually move into your home. Call a professional to remove any unwelcome substances from your roof. The surface can be quite slippery.

Spot Structural Damage

roof shinglesIf you notice that the shingles are missing, buckling, cracked, or curling, it may be time for a new roof. A roofing professional can assess whether they can solve the issue by replacing just the shingles or fully replacing the roof. Just be sure to spot these issues as soon as possible, as it’s best to catch damage before it spreads.

Keep Branches Clear

Be sure to remove any tree branches that hang over your roof. The branches could fall in a windstorm and scratch your shingles. Leaves can also collect on top of the shingles and accumulate moisture. Over time, the shingles might start to rot or become moldy.
